Remote Technical Project Manager 3

Remote, USA Full-time
Spectra Tech has an immediate need for a Remote Technical Project Manager 3 in Los Alamos, NM. The technical project manager manages and ensures the timely completion of discrete technical or operational projects; establishes technical requirements for the project; defines project deliverables, schedules, and communicates risks; and oversees a project from the planning, tracking, and execution of the project from initiation to completion. Projects are a set of related activities needed to produce specific products or services to meet customer's requirements. The TPM 3 will define what will be accomplished to meet specific programmatic needs and produce the work products defined by the work assignments. They will function in an oversight role that will include contributing to the development, implementation and evaluation of program policies, procedures and standards; determining program enhancements; providing technical advice to staff, other departments, and performs related work as required. Prefer prior DOE experience supporting D&D, environmental restoration and 413.3B construction projects. Experience in developing and nurturing effective high-level internal and/or external customer relationships. Must have documented experience performing management assessments, causal analysis, tracking and trending of Performance Assurance data, and development of Performance Assurance metrics. Ability to successfully plan, organize, lead, and monitor a wide variety of team efforts to completion. Ability to prepare and deliver performance status communications to all levels of management, both internal and external. Education: Position typically requires a bachelor's degree and a minimum twelve years of related experience, or an equivalent combination of education and experience. Experience: Minimum 12 years in Department of Energy, 5 years supporting a Cat II Nuclear Facility and documented experience with DevonWay/Ideagen.
